Overview

This investigational cell therapy combination, developed by Translational Biosciences, consists of allogeneic human umbilical cord-derived mesenchymal stem cells (UC-MSC) and autologous bone marrow mononuclear cells (BMMC). It is currently being evaluated in Phase 1/2 clinical trials for the treatment of spinal cord injury (SCI). The therapeutic approach utilizes the synergistic effects of both cell types: UC-MSCs provide immunomodulatory and neurotrophic support to reduce secondary injury and promote a regenerative environment, while BMMCs, which include various progenitor populations, are intended to support revascularization and tissue repair. The treatment protocol involves a dual administration route, combining intravenous and intrathecal injections to optimize cell delivery to the central nervous system and systemic circulation.
